How to get to Col des Lèques by car

To reach the Col des Lèques on the D4085 from Castellane, you need to drive about 9 kilometers. Here’s how to get there:

From Castellane, follow the D4085 towards Barrême.
Continue on the D4085 until you reach the Col des Lèques.

From Digne-les-Bains, the Col des Lèques on the D4085 is around 45 kilometers away by car. Here’s how to get there:

From Digne-les-Bains, take the D900 towards La Javie.
At La Javie, follow the signs for the D4085 towards Barrême.
Continue on the D4085 to the Col des Lèques.

How to get to the Cadieres de Brandis hike from Col des Lèques

To reach Cadières de Brandis from the Col des Lèques in the Verdon, here is a suggested itinerary:

1.Departure from Col des Lèques: From Col des Lèques, follow the signposted path eastwards towards Cadières de Brandis. Make sure you follow the signs to avoid getting lost along the way.
2.Crossing lush green landscapes : The trail takes you through a variety of landscapes. Green meadows, holm oak forests and garrigues typical of the Verdon region. Take the opportunity to admire the diversity of local flora and fauna.
3.Ascent to the crests: As you advance along the trail, the slope becomes steeper. You’ll then begin a gradual ascent to the ridges where Cadières de Brandis is located. Be prepared for the sometimes steep and rocky terrain, requiring good fitness and agility.
4.Arrival at Cadières de Brandis: After a hike of around 2-3 hours, depending on your pace and level of fitness, you’ll reach Cadières de Brandis. These spectacular rock formations offer breathtaking panoramic views of the Verdon Gorge and surrounding countryside. How to prepare for the Cadieres de Brandis hike

Proper preparation is essential if you are to enjoy the experience in complete safety.

Equipment required for the Cadieres de Brandis hike

Sturdy hiking boots are recommended, offering good grip and support on the varied terrain encountered along the way. Weather-appropriate clothing is also essential, as the climate can be changeable in the mountains. It is crucial to bring sufficient water and energy snacks to maintain hydration and nutrition levels during the effort. A detailed map of the region and a compass can prove useful for orientation, especially in more remote areas where the GPS signal may be weak.
